Balance this chemical equation with an explanation please: CH3CH2OH + O2 = CO2 + H2O

Respuesta :

nonochoden nonochoden
  • 12-09-2017
CH3CH2OH + 3O2 = 2CO2 + 3H2O

Basically you do trial and error on both sides so they can be equal
